3D Printing in Dental Surgery



To enhance the area of oral surgery, you can discover the subtopic of 3D printing in dental surgery. This cutting-edge technology has the potential to reinvent the way oral surgeons run and treat individuals. Below are four key methods which 3D printing is shaping the field:

- ** Personalized Surgical Guides **: 3D printing permits the creation of extremely precise and patient-specific medical overviews, improving the accuracy and efficiency of procedures.

- ** Implant Prosthetics **: With 3D printing, oral surgeons can create customized implant prosthetics that perfectly fit a client's special anatomy, causing much better outcomes and individual fulfillment.

- ** Bone Grafting **: 3D printing enables the manufacturing of patient-specific bone grafts, minimizing the requirement for standard implanting strategies and improving recovery and healing time.

- ** Education and Educating **: 3D printing can be made use of to produce practical surgical designs for instructional objectives, enabling dental cosmetic surgeons to exercise intricate procedures prior to performing them on patients.

Minimally Intrusive Strategies



To better advance the area of dental surgery, accept the possibility of minimally intrusive strategies that can greatly benefit both specialists and individuals alike.

Minimally intrusive strategies are revolutionizing the field by reducing medical injury, lessening post-operative discomfort, and speeding up the recuperation process. These techniques entail utilizing smaller incisions and specialized tools to execute treatments with precision and effectiveness.

By making use of sophisticated imaging modern technology, such as cone beam calculated tomography (CBCT), specialists can precisely prepare and perform surgical procedures with marginal invasiveness.

In addition, the use of lasers in oral surgery allows for precise cells cutting and coagulation, causing decreased blood loss and lowered healing time.

With minimally intrusive techniques, individuals can experience faster recovery, minimized scarring, and enhanced results, making it an important element of the future of dental surgery.
